There is another interesting twist from RR's deposition. RR's lawyer claims that RR's wife Rita has been hired by the attorney as an agent for this lawsuit (you can't make this stuff up). LOL!!! Outside of constitutional criminal proceedings and constitutional criminal rights there is no interspousal immunity preventing one spouse from testifying about conversations and dealings with the other spouse. RR's attorney refused to allow RR to testify about conversations RR had with Rita or with others while Rita was in their presence. The judge is going to love this.
